In a significant step towards improving water service in Southaven, the Mayor and Board of Aldermen approved an agreement with the Nesbitt Water Association during their recent meeting on July 15, 2025. This agreement, which is contingent upon approval from the Public Service Commission (PSC) and final consent from Nesbitt Water, aims to streamline water service delivery in overlapping areas of the two entities.
The agreement specifically addresses a section of the Nesbitt Water Association's certificate area that overlaps with Southaven's corporate limits, particularly along Long Star Landing Road, extending from I-55 eastward to Getwell Road. Under the new arrangement, Nesbitt Water will continue to provide water services to its customers in this area, except for specific zones north of Star Landing and west of Getwell, which will now be serviced by Southaven.
This transition will allow Southaven to take over water service responsibilities in certain neighborhoods, including parts of the Magnolia Glen Subdivision and areas adjacent to Sweeney Road. In return, Nesbitt Water will continue to collect sewer fees for these areas at a rate of $1.75 per meter per month, ensuring that residents receive consistent billing for sewer services.
The agreement is expected to enhance operational efficiency and improve service delivery for residents in the affected areas. The Mayor emphasized the collaborative efforts of city officials and engineers from both Southaven and Nesbitt Water in crafting this agreement, which is seen as a positive move for the community.
With the motion passed, the next steps involve awaiting PSC approval to finalize the agreement, marking a proactive approach to managing water resources and infrastructure in Southaven.
